Grp Synthesizer V22 Analog Vocoder Rev 1.3 2. WHAT IS A VOCODER The Vocoder is an analog circuit conceived in the first half of the last century. Its operation is based on the possibility of adapting the harmonic and energy content of a spoken signal called Speech or Modulator to a second electronic signal - indifferently monophonic or polyphonic - called Carrier;...

Grp Synthesizer V22 Analog Vocoder Rev 1.3 3.3.1 VOICED/UNVOICED SELECTION The Voiced/Unvoiced selection engine allows you to optimize the quality of the Carrier signal by smoothly adapting it to the characteristics of the spoken signal received at the input of the Analysis section; when pronouncing vowels or diphthongs, the Carrier must be sufficiently rich in acute harmonics, but must mainly offer a good amount of energy on the frequencies normally used by human speech;...

Grp Synthesizer V22 Analog Vocoder Rev 1.3 4.5 SLEW SECTION Adjusts the response speed of the Envelope Followers present in the Analysis section of the signal. 4.5.1 FREEZE Switch In the ON position, it freezes the decay of the Envelope Followers, prolonging endlessly the reading of the analysis signals.
Grp Synthesizer V22 Analog Vocoder Rev 1.3 4.6 VOICED/UNVOICED SECTION It contains all the controls related to the generation of the Carrier signals inside the Vocoder (Voiced-Oscil- lator, Unvoiced-Noise Generator), with the possibility of receiving external signals alternative to those pro- duced internally and the customization of Voiced/Unvoiced operation variations.

Grp Synthesizer V22 Analog Vocoder Rev 1.3 4.10.2 INPUT - SLEW 0/+5V It allows remote control of the SLEW response speed of the Envelope Followers present in the Analysis sec- tion. By applying a voltage equal to + 5V, the Freeze condition is obtained.
Grp Synthesizer V22 Analog Vocoder Rev 1.3 These adjust the output levels of the individual Synthesis bands. They allow to “re-equalize” the signal pro- duced by the Vocoder. If the VCA INIT GAIN command is not at minimum value, it is possible to use the Vocoder as Fixed Filter Bank on the signal present at the EXT.VOICED input.
